: Conduct a thorough title search to confirm if mineral rights have been severed. A standard title policy often excludes mineral rights, so you may need a specialized "Quiet Title Action" if ownership is disputed.

: If the rights are currently non-producing, they may be valued between $25 and $250 per acre . Once leased, typical royalty rates for oil and gas range from 12.5% to 25% . buying land with mineral rights

: Be aware that any income generated from royalties or bonuses is taxable. You may be subject to income, severance, or ad valorem taxes depending on your location. Community Insights

: In most jurisdictions, the "mineral estate" is dominant. This means if you don't own the mineral rights, the owner of those rights may have the legal authority to access the surface of your property to extract resources.
